Chicken and mushrooms are a classic combination. This pairing has been around for centuries and is a staple in many cultures. The combination of the two ingredients is delicious, healthy, and versatile. Whether you are cooking for a special occasion or just a family dinner, this duo will be a hit.

Mushrooms are full of essential minerals and vitamins and provide a rich source of antioxidants. They are also low in calories, fat, and cholesterol. These superfoods are also a great source of dietary fiber, which can help in weight management and digestion.

Chicken is a lean, healthy protein that provides your body with all the essential amino acids, vitamins, and minerals. It can also help you feel full for longer and is rich in iron, calcium, and Vitamin B12.

When you combine the two, you get a meal that is packed with flavor and nutrition. Here are some of our favorite chicken recipes with mushrooms that you can try at home.

Mushroom Stuffed Chicken Breasts

This easy and delicious dish is perfect for busy weeknights. It takes only 30 minutes to prepare and is sure to be a hit with the whole family. Start by preheating your oven to 375 degrees Fahrenheit. Take four boneless, skinless chicken breasts and butterfly them, and then season with salt and pepper.

In a skillet, sauté one cup of diced mushrooms with one tablespoon of olive oil. Once the mushrooms are cooked through, add one cup of cooked quinoa, one cup of grated Parmesan cheese, and two tablespoons of chopped fresh parsley. Mix together until everything is combined.

Stuff each chicken breast with the mushroom and quinoa mixture and then top with one tablespoon of melted butter. Place the chicken breasts in a baking dish and bake for 20 minutes, or until the chicken is cooked through. Serve with your favorite side dish and enjoy!

Mushroom Chicken Marsala

This classic Italian dish is sure to become a family favorite. Start by preheating your oven to 375 degrees Fahrenheit. Take four boneless, skinless chicken breasts and season with salt and pepper.

In a large skillet, heat one tablespoon of olive oil over medium-high heat. Add one cup of sliced mushrooms and sauté until they are browned. Remove the mushrooms and set aside.

In the same skillet, heat two tablespoons of butter. Add the chicken breasts and cook for about five minutes per side, or until the chicken is cooked through. Remove the chicken and set aside.

Add one cup of Marsala wine to the skillet and reduce the heat to low. Stir in one tablespoon of flour and cook for one minute, or until the sauce has thickened. Add the mushrooms back to the skillet and cook for an additional two minutes.

Return the chicken to the skillet and spoon the sauce over the top. Bake in the preheated oven for 15 minutes, or until the chicken is cooked through. Serve with your favorite side dish and enjoy!

Mushroom Chicken Alfredo

This creamy, comforting dish is sure to please even the pickiest of eaters. Start by preheating your oven to 375 degrees Fahrenheit. Take four boneless, skinless chicken breasts and season with salt and pepper.

In a large skillet, heat one tablespoon of olive oil over medium-high heat. Add one cup of sliced mushrooms and sauté until they are browned. Remove the mushrooms and set aside.

In the same skillet, heat two tablespoons of butter. Add the chicken breasts and cook for about five minutes per side, or until the chicken is cooked through. Remove the chicken and set aside.

Add one cup of heavy cream to the skillet and reduce the heat to low. Simmer for two minutes and then stir in one cup of grated Parmesan cheese. Add the mushrooms back to the skillet and cook for an additional two minutes.

Return the chicken to the skillet and spoon the sauce over the top. Bake in the preheated oven for 15 minutes, or until the chicken is cooked through. Serve with your favorite side dish and enjoy!

Mushroom Chicken Stir Fry

This flavorful stir fry is a great way to use up any leftover chicken you may have. Start by preheating your wok or skillet over medium-high heat. Add one tablespoon of olive oil and swirl to coat the pan.

Add one pound of diced chicken and season with salt and pepper. Cook for about five minutes, or until the chicken is cooked through. Add one cup of sliced mushrooms and cook for an additional two minutes.

Add one cup of cooked brown rice, one cup of frozen vegetables, and two tablespoons of soy sauce. Stir to combine and cook for two minutes, or until the vegetables are heated through.

Serve the stir fry with your favorite side dishes, such as steamed broccoli or a side salad. Enjoy!
